| Strip-Till, Corn on Soybean, Nitrogen Rate Study | |||||||||||||||
| L. Besemann and H. Eslinger | |||||||||||||||
| The objective of this study was to compare corn yields of a corn/soybean rotation to those in a companion corn/corn rotation and to find differences in N response and other agronomic measurements in no-till rotations, utilizing strip-till. | |||||||||||||||
| MATERIALS AND METHODS | |||||||||||||||
| Soil: | Embden sandy loam, Embden loam, Gardena loam and Maddock sandy loam. Soil N average 14 lbs/acre. | ||||||||||||||
| Previous crop: | 2012 – soybean. | ||||||||||||||
| Seedbed preparation: | Strip-till May 18 with an Orthman strip-till machine. | ||||||||||||||
| Hybrid: | Pioneer P0062AMX | ||||||||||||||
| Planting: | Planted May 18 @ 33,000 plants per acre in 30-inch rows. | ||||||||||||||
| Plots: | Plots were 37 ft long by 15 ft (6 rows) wide. There were four replications. | ||||||||||||||
| Fertilizer: | All plots received a broadcast application of 31 lbs N/acre, 103 lbs P2O5/acre, 95 lbs K2O/acre, 26 lbs S/acre, and 3 lbs Zn/acre as 7‑25-23-6-1 May 2. All plots received 12 lbs N/acre and 40 lbs P2O5/acre as 10-34-0 via strip-till May 18. Stream‑bar all plots with 10 lbs N/acre and 23 lbs S/acre as 12‑0-0-26 May 23. Stream-bar 79 lbs N/acre as 28-0-0 to the 100 lb treatment and 44 lbs N/acre as 28‑0-0 to the 100D, 150 and 200 lb treatments May 25. Sidedress N treatments as 28‑0-0 (three inches deep) June 18; 200 lb treatments received 135 lbs N/acre, the 150 lb treatment received 85 lbs N/acre and the 100D received 35 lbs N/acre. | ||||||||||||||
| Irrigation: | Overhead sprinkler irrigation as needed. | ||||||||||||||
| Pest control: | Outlook (18 oz/acre) May 23, Laudis (3 oz/acre) + Roundup Power Max (40 oz/acre) + AAtrex 9-O (0.5 lb ai/acre) + Destiny (0.05%v/v) + AMS (1½ lbs/acre) June 13. | ||||||||||||||
| Remote sensing: | Remote sensing was achieved with an Opti-Sciences CCM 200 Plus chlorophyll meter and a Holland Crop Circle ACS active canopy sensor (normalized difference red edge – NDRE). | ||||||||||||||
| Harvest: | Hand harvest October 16 - October 18. Harvest area was the two center rows from each plot (72 feet of total row). | ||||||||||||||
| RESULTS | |||||||||||||||
| Determining nitrogen sufficiency in time is important to achieve N efficiency. Remote sensing utilizing a Holland Crop Circle ACS 430 active canopy sensor (normalized difference red edge – NDRE) and a Opti-Science CCM 200 chlorophyll meter were tested to determine ability to measure N sufficiency. | |||||||||||||||
| Increasing nitrogen rates (N) increased grain yield, chlorophyll meter readings and normalized difference red edge (NDRE). Remote sensing by chlorophyll meter and the Crop Circle Sensor did well in predicting corn N status. | |||||||||||||||
| Table 1. Strip-till, corn on soybean nitrogen rate study at the Oakes Irrigation Research Site in 2013. | |||||||||||||||
| Grain | Chlorophyll | ||||||||||||||
| Fertilizer | Grain | Yield | Harvest | Test | Meter | Nitrate-N | Seed | Emerge | Silk4 | Mature | |||||
| N Rate | Yield1 | 2009-13 | Moisture | Weight | Reading2 | NDRE3 | Stalk | Fall Soil | Population | Oil | Protein | Starch | Date | Date | Date |
| lb/acre | bu/ac | bu/ac | % | lb/bu | 6-Aug | 5-Aug | ppm | lbs | plants/ac | ----------%----------- | |||||
| 22 | 158.8 | 129.4 | 24.4 | 46.6 | 18.4 | 0.3114 | 71 | 19 | 34848 | 1.7 | 6.9 | 76.5 | 31-May | 211.3 | 22-Sep |
| 100 | 200.7 | 185.0 | 24.3 | 47.2 | 27.3 | 0.3310 | 342 | 21 | 35613 | 2.0 | 7.5 | 75.6 | 31-May | 210.8 | 23-Sep |
| 100 D | 216.9 | 194.9 | 23.6 | 47.4 | 32.4 | 0.3170 | 137 | 21 | 36084 | 2.1 | 7.9 | 75.2 | 31-May | 211.8 | 23-Sep |
| 150 | 242.9 | 227.0 | 23.4 | 47.6 | 37.4 | 0.3270 | 1026 | 24 | 35849 | 2.0 | 8.3 | 74.8 | 31-May | 212.0 | 23-Sep |
| 200 | 245.3 | 236.1 | 23.2 | 48.2 | 40.8 | 0.3234 | 1903 | 28 | 35672 | 2.1 | 8.7 | 74.6 | 31-May | 211.0 | 23-Sep |
| Mean | 212.9 | 23.8 | 47.4 | 31.3 | 0.3220 | 696 | 22.6 | 2.0 | 7.9 | 75.3 | 211.4 | ||||
| C.V. (%) | 5.1 | 2.7 | 0.9 | 9.7 | 9.2 | 63.4 | 9.3 | 10.3 | 3.1 | 0.5 | 0.5 | ||||
| LSD 0.10 | 13.6 | 0.8 | 0.5 | 3.8 | NS | 556 | 2.6 | 0.3 | 0.3 | 0.5 | NS | ||||
| LSD 0.05 | 16.6 | NS | 0.6 | 4.7 | NS | 679 | 3.2 | NS | 0.4 | 0.6 | NS | ||||
| Planting Date = May 18; Harvest Date = October 17; Previous Crop = Soybean | |||||||||||||||
| 1 Yield adjusted to 15.5% moisture. | |||||||||||||||
| 2 Opti-Science CCM 200. | |||||||||||||||
| 3 Holland Crop Circle ACS active canopy sensor (normalized difference red edge) - NDRE. | |||||||||||||||
| 4 Jday of Silk: Julian day of year when hybrids reached 50% silk. Example: Jday 211 = July 30. | |||||||||||||||
